## Idempotency Keys for Payment Retries (Lumopay)

Every retry of a charge request must reuse the original idempotency key; generating a new key on retry can produce duplicate charges. Keys are scoped per merchant and expire after 48 hours. Reviewers should verify keys are derived server-side, never from client input. The full key-generation specification and threat model are maintained on the internal page.

dashboard of kaguf-tawip = https://vault.merlaqsys.test/issue

### Account Recovery — Catalogue Import (Lintwood)

Quick one for review: when the Lintwood catalogue import wipes a patron's session table, the recovery flow re-seeds accounts from the nightly snapshot. Check that the importer skips locked accounts — last time it didn't. To rerun recovery against staging you'll need the vault passphrase, which is appended just below.

recovery phrase for yafof-tajof: julmir-kelax-julvan-holath-belvan-holir-ralael-ralvan-ralath-julvan-silmir-istmir-kaswyn-ulamir

Capacity note for the Haulwick fuel-usage report: month-end runs now pull ~40M odometer rows, and the aggregation workers hit memory pressure above three concurrent tenants. If the queue backs up past an hour, scale workers before touching batch size — shrinking batches inflates runtime badly. The current limits, validated during the Ostermoor fleet onboarding, are set as follows.

limits module of taguf-bafog:
WEIGHTS = {
    "oliok": 618,
    "istiel": 638,
    "holok": 468,
    "norael": 653,
    "eliys": 63,
    "eliax": 785,
    "fraeth": 507,
}